Understanding Water Pipes Under the Sink A Comprehensive Guide


When it comes to the plumbing of our homes, one area often overlooked is the network of water pipes that lie beneath our sinks. These pipes are essential for delivering fresh water to our faucets and draining wastewater efficiently. Understanding the various components and functions of these water pipes can help homeowners maintain their plumbing systems and address minor issues without the need for a professional plumber.


Common Types of Water Pipes Under the Sink


Under the sink, you’ll typically find three types of pipes the supply lines, the drain pipe, and the trap.


1. Supply Lines These are the pipes that bring fresh water into your sink. They are usually made of copper, PEX, or PVC. Copper pipes are known for their durability and resistance to corrosion, while PEX is flexible and can be easier to install in tight spaces. PVC is often used for both drains and venting due to its lightweight nature and resistance to corrosion.


2. Drain Pipe This pipe carries wastewater away from your sink and into the home's drainage system. It is typically made of PVC or ABS plastic. The drain pipe is larger than the supply lines to accommodate the greater volume of wastewater.


3. Trap Positioned right below the sink, the trap is a U-shaped pipe that retains a small amount of water. This water acts as a barrier to prevent sewer gases from entering the home. If the trap becomes clogged, it can lead to slow drainage or backups, which is a common issue many homeowners face.


Importance of Proper Installation


Proper installation of these pipes is crucial for efficient plumbing. Poorly installed pipes can result in leaks, which can lead to water damage and mold growth. When installing or replacing pipes under your sink, ensure that all connections are tight, and use appropriate fittings for the material of the pipes. It’s advisable to use Teflon tape on threaded connections to create a watertight seal.

To keep your water pipes under the sink in good condition, regular maintenance is key. Here are some practical tips


1. Check for Leaks Periodically inspect the area under your sink for signs of leaks. Look for water stains or dampness around the pipes. If you notice any leaks, tighten the fittings or replace damaged pipes as necessary.


2. Clean the Trap The trap can accumulate debris over time, leading to clogs. To keep it clear, remove the trap (make sure to place a bucket underneath to catch any water) and clean it with warm, soapy water.


3. Watch What Goes Down the Drain Be mindful of what you dispose of in your sink. Avoid putting grease, coffee grounds, and fibrous foods down the drain, as these can easily cause blockages.


4. Use Caustic Drain Cleaners Sparingly While chemical drain cleaners can effectively unclog pipes, they can also be harsh on your plumbing. Consider using a natural method, like a mixture of baking soda and vinegar, to clear minor clogs.


Upgrading Your Plumbing


If you’re dealing with frequent plumbing issues, it may be time to consider an upgrade. Modern piping solutions, such as flexible PEX tubing, offer many advantages, including resistance to freeze damage and ease of installation. Switching to high-quality materials can save you money in the long run by reducing the likelihood of repairs.
